Murugappa cup hockey from Sep 4

By IANS,

Chennai : The prestigious All-India MCC Murugappa Cup hockey tournament stages a comeback after a two-year absence with nine teams in the fray at the Mayor Radhakrishnan Stadium here Sep 4-14.

“The event was not held last year due to tight schedule of domestic events and the busy programme of the Indian teams. The Murugappa Group of Companies has increased the prize money to Rs. 1.5 lakh (Rs.150,000) for the winners and Rs. 1 lakh (Rs.100,000) for runners-up,” said Arun Murugappan, managing director of the group firm Parry Enterprises India Limited.

In all, 10 teams, including defending champions BPCL, have been invited.

Murugappan said the tournament has been categorised as a Grade A competition.

The 10 teams have been divided into two pools of five for the preliminary league. The top two finishers in each pool will advance to the semifinals.

The Pools:
Pool A: Indian Oil Corporation, Karnataka XI, Mumbai XI, Indian Railways and Indian Overseas Bank.

Pool B: Bharat Petroleum Corporation, Air India, Namdhari XI, Sports Hostel (Orissa) and Army XI.
